Main healthcare covers a broad range of health services, consisting of diagnosis and treatment, health education, counselling, disease avoidance and screening. A strong main health care system is main to improving the health of all New Zealanders and lowering health inequalities between various groups. The launch of the Main Healthcare Technique in 2001, followed by the establishment of primary health organisations (PHOs), set the instructions and vision for primary healthcare services in New Zealand.

The following 5 definitions connecting to primary care needs to be taken together. They explain the care offered to the patient, the system of providing such care, the kinds of doctors whose role in the system is to offer primary care, and the function of other physicians, and non-physicians, in offering such care.
Medical care is that care offered by doctors particularly trained for and knowledgeable in extensive very first contact and continuing look after persons with any undiagnosed sign, sign, or health concern (the "undifferentiated" patient) not restricted by problem origin (biological, behavioral, or social), organ system, or medical diagnosis. Medical care includes health promo, illness avoidance, health upkeep, counseling, client education, diagnosis and treatment of severe and chronic diseases in a range of health care settings (e.

Primary care is carried out and handled by an individual doctor often collaborating with other health professionals, and making use of assessment or recommendation as suitable. Main care supplies client advocacy in the healthcare system to achieve cost-efficient care by coordination of health care services. Main care promotes effective communication with clients and encourages the function of the patient as a partner in health care.
Medical care practices provide patients with prepared access to their own individual doctor, or to an established back-up physician when the main physician is not offered. A medical care physician is a specialist in Household Medication, Internal Medication or Pediatrics who provides conclusive care to the undifferentiated client at the point of very first contact, and takes continuing obligation for supplying the patient's thorough care. This care might consist of persistent, preventive and intense care in both inpatient and outpatient settings.
Primary care doctors dedicate the bulk of their practice to supplying main care services to a defined population of patients. The design of primary care practice is such that the personal medical care doctor functions as the entry point for considerably Mental Health Facility all of the client's medical and healthcare requires - not limited by problem origin, organ system, or diagnosis.
Physicians who are not trained in the medical care specialties of household medicine, basic internal medication, or basic pediatrics may in some cases supply patient care services that are typically provided by medical care physicians. These doctors might focus on specific patient care requires associated to prevention, health maintenance, acute care, chronic care or rehab.
